On august 4, 1990, 11-year-old heidi seeman was walking home after spending the night at a friend's house when she was abducted. Her friend, who had walked her halfway home, last saw heidi at stahl road and willow run on san antonio's northeast side. A witness described a shiny red car with tinted windows and a thin red stripe down the side. They were seen driving in the neighborhood in a suspicious manner just before heidi seeman was abducted. On august 25, 1990, the decomposed remains of heidi seeman were found in an isolated property off county road 220 in hays county, texas. Medical examiner dr. Dimiao ruled the cause of death as a homicide. Over the years several leads and suspects have been investigated, but not enough evidence has been found for police to file a case. Police are asking for your help in finding the person(s) responsible for this senseless murder of a young girl.
